Biography
Roxanne supplies an outstanding service from a fully qualified English teacher and an AQA examiner. Roxanne marks the GCSE English exam papers for the AQA exam board each Summer. This means that she has the very latest training and knows exactly how to enable students to secure the most marks in their exams.
She's worked in both mainstream and special needs schools. She has worked with students with a variety of learning needs such as autism, ADHD, cerebral palsy and dyslexia helping students to access the curriculum and make progress. Roxanne personalises her tuition to help every child reach their full potential.
Her skills have been recognised by the schools she has worked at and as such she was nominated as the gifted and talented coordinator for English and later in her career became the drama department head.
